Output 966672ca226ca593e033bfe16ff634d380e47582463311beabfa59ffce96f8e2:1

value
101303
script pubkey
OP_0 OP_PUSHBYTES_32 1d8e4c19625ad922ddcfcd6bea84dcd3ae8498732264a700ec37d79ad8f8b075
address
bc1qrk8ycxtzttvj9hw0e4474pxu6whgfxrnyfj2wq8vxlte4k8ckp6sh4enry
transaction
966672ca226ca593e033bfe16ff634d380e47582463311beabfa59ffce96f8e2
confirmations
3454
spent
true